#2f4b65 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#2f4b65 is composed of 18.4% red, 29.4%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.5% cyan, 25.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 208.9 degrees, a saturation of 36.5% and a lightness of 29%. #2f4b65 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e96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#2f4b65 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.

The hexadecimal color #2f4b65 has RGB values of R:47, G:75,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3099493.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030507 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464a4e is the less saturated color, while #014d93 is the most saturated one.
